Banana Bread

I made this tonight. It has no eggs, and no oil.

  • 1 Cup flour
  • 1/2 Cup Whole Wheat flour (or 1 1/2 cups reg flour)
  • 1/2 Cup brown sugar
  • 1 1/2 tsp baking pow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 1 cup oats
  • 1 cup mashed banana
  • 1/3 cup skim milk
  • 1/4 apple sauce (or 1/4 cup Oil)
  • 1 tsp vanilla (I used more)
  • 2 TB Ground Flaxseed mixed with
  • 6 TB Water (OR 2 eggs)
  • 2/3 cup raisins or chocolate chips or nuts OPTIONAL (I use what I have on hand)
  • Preheat oven to 350°F and spray a 8 x 4 inch loaf pan with cooking spray.
  • Combine dry ingredients together in a large bowl.
  • Combine banana, milk, flaxseed and water, vanilla, and applesauces in a small bowl or measuring cup.
  • Pour w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and stir gently
  • just until the dry ingredients are moistened. or the bread will be tough.
  • Pour batter into the prepared pan and bake for 55 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ean
  • Cool on a wire rack, in the pan, for about 15 minutes
